PHP、Zend Framework与JAVE:探索跨平台开发的强大组合
在当今的软件开发环境中,选择合适的编程语言和技术框架对于项目的成功至关重要,PHP、JAVE(Java)和C++是三种广泛应用的编程语言,而Zend Framework则是一个功能强大且易于使用的开源PHP框架,本文将探讨这三者之间的结合,以及它们如何共同为开发者提供强大的跨平台开发能力。
我们来了解一下这三者的基本特点。
1、PHP:一种开源的通用脚本语言,特别适合于Web开发并可以嵌入到HTML中,PHP学习曲线较平缓,语法简洁明了,易于上手,PHP拥有丰富的库和框架资源,如Laravel、Symfony等,可以帮助开发者快速构建高性能的Web应用。
2、Zend Framework:一个基于MVC(Model-View-Controller)设计模式的开源PHP框架,它提供了一套完整的解决方案,包括数据库抽象、表单处理、URL路由等功能,使得开发者能够专注于业务逻辑的开发,而无需从零开始搭建整个项目框架,Zend Framework的优点在于其模块化的设计,允许开发者根据需求灵活地选择和扩展组件。
3、JAVE(Java):一种面向对象的编程语言,具有跨平台、安全性高、可移植性强等特点,Java广泛应用于企业级应用开发、移动应用开发以及Web应用开发等多个领域,Java生态系统庞大,拥有众多优秀的开源库和框架,如Spring、Hibernate等,可以帮助开发者快速构建各种类型的应用。
我们将探讨如何将这三者结合起来,实现高效的跨平台开发。
1、使用PHP作为后端语言:由于PHP语法简洁明了,易于学习和上手,因此将其作为后端语言是一个很好的选择,通过使用诸如Laravel、Symfony等流行的PHP框架,开发者可以快速构建出高性能的Web应用。
2、使用Zend Framework作为基础架构:Zend Framework提供了一套完整的解决方案,可以帮助开发者快速搭建项目框架,通过使用Zend Framework,开发者可以专注于业务逻辑的开发,而无需从零开始搭建整个项目框架,Zend Framework的模块化设计也使得开发者可以根据需求灵活地选择和扩展组件。
3、使用JAVE作为前端技术:虽然PHP主要用于Web开发,但通过使用诸如React、Vue等前端框架,开发者也可以实现跨平台的应用开发,这些前端框架通常基于JavaScript或其他客户端渲染引擎,可以与PHP后端进行数据交互,并在不同的平台上运行。
通过将PHP、Zend Framework和JAVE结合使用,开发者可以充分利用各自的优势,实现高效的跨平台开发,这种组合不仅能够提高开发效率,还有助于降低项目的维护成本,在未来的软件开发中,这种跨平台的开发方式将会越来越受到欢迎。
还没有评论,来说两句吧...